## Abstract

This rule amends the danger zone regulations by redesignating an aerial firing range as an aerial and surface firing range and increases the use of the firing range and target area in the waters of the Chesapeake Bay. It also increases the use of the firing range from Monday through Saturday, except holidays, to continuous use. The restricted area of the Hannibal Target previously encompassed a water area with a radius of 600 yards. The change increases the radius of the restricted area to 1000 yards, prohibits entry into the areas at all times and prohibits the public from climbing on the targets. These changes are necessary to protect the public from hazardous conditions which may exist as a result of the U.S. Navy's use of the area. Other editorial amendments are made to reflect changes in the Navy's organization.
